IDARG_IN_GETSRMLISTVERSION 구조체(iddcx.h)

IDARG_IN_GETSRMLISTVERSIONIddCxMonitorGetSrmListVersion에 대한 입력 구조입니다.

구문

struct IDARG_IN_GETSRMLISTVERSION {
  [in] UINT  SrmListVersionBufferInputCount;
       PVOID pSrmListVerion;
};

멤버

[in] SrmListVersionBufferInputCount

pSrmListVersion을 통해 드라이버가 OS에 전달하는 버퍼의 크기(바이트)입니다. 값이 0이면 드라이버가 드라이버에서 제공해야 하는 SRM 목록 버전 버퍼의 크기를 단순히 쿼리하고 있음을 나타냅니다. 이 경우 OS는 출력 구조에서 버퍼 크기를 설정합니다.

SrmListVersionBufferInputCount는 0이어야 하고 pSrmListVersion은 null로 설정하거나 SrmListVersionBufferInputCount는 0이 아니어야 하며 pSrmListVerion은 null이 아니어야 합니다.

pSrmListVerion

값이 NULL이 아닌 경우 OS가 SRM 목록 버전을 복사해야 하는 버퍼에 대한 포인터입니다. 이 경우 버전 형식은 PlayReady 포팅 키트 4.0에 의해 정의됩니다.

pSrmListVerion이 NULL인 경우 OS는 데이터를 복사하지 않고 값을 IDARG_OUT_GETSRMLISTVERSION 설정합니다. SRM 목록 버전을 저장하는 데 필요한 버퍼 크기를 나타내는 SrmListVersionBufferOutputCount입니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 10
머리글 iddcx.h

추가 정보

IDARG_OUT_GETSRMLISTVERSION

IddCxMonitorGetSrmListVersion